流程控制概述 if語句

2021-10-06 20:32:59 字數 915 閱讀 4386

流程控制結構:

順序結構:程式中的各項操作有出現順序執行

分支結構:程式的處理步驟出現分支,需要根據特定條件做出選擇其中乙個分支執行

迴圈結構:程式反覆執行某個或某一些操作,直到條件成立菜終止迴圈

順序結構是預設結構

分支結構語句:if 分支語句 switch 分支語句

迴圈結構語句:while 迴圈語句 do while 迴圈語句 for迴圈語句

if 語句

if的三種形式:

第一種:if (邏輯表示式/布林表示式)

在邏輯表示式中返回真執行的是大括號中的假則執行後面的

第二種:if (邏輯表示式)else

條件成立執行if後面的**不成立執行else中的

第三種:if (邏輯表示式) else if(邏輯表示式)else

if的邏輯表示式返回真執行if後面大括號的**假則執行else if中的邏輯表示式也是真執行大括號假執行else後的大括號

注(其中else if可以出現無限次)

例:輸入乙個整數判斷是奇數還是偶數

輸入乙個奇數:

第三種:對考試成績進行判斷分五個檔次

假設成績為整數

注(當條件具有包含關係時,需要把被包含的條件寫在前面)

Python流程控制語句流程控制語句

流程控制語句1 if語句 if 語句基本用法 if 表示式 語句塊其中,表示式可以是乙個單純的布林值或變數,也可以是比較表示式或邏輯表示式,如果表示式為真,則執行 語句塊 如果表示式的值為假,就跳 過 語句塊 繼續執行後面的語句。2 if else語句 if else 語句基本用法 if 表示式 語...

流程控制語句

for a b c 若迴圈體中出現continue,c語句仍得到執行。while dowhile b 執行完do後大括號,再檢驗while b 條件,若為真,繼續。從而有a語句塊至少執行一次的特性。continue 迴圈體內餘下語句忽略,繼續下次迴圈。break用於跳出迴圈或switch.case....

流程控制語句

迴圈 while do while for 判斷 if else switch case 異常處理 try catch finally throw 分支 break continue label return 迴圈 while和do while語句 while語句用於在條件保持為true時反覆執行乙...